tdata_csr_write is approachable by guest programs. In case of unassigned values written to a tdata CSR in debug mode, the switch-case falls through straight to default causing an immediate abort. The risc-v spec says:All tdata registers follow write-any-read-legal semantics. If a debugger writes an unsupported configuration, the register will read back a value that is supported (which may simply be a disabled trigger). This means that a debugger must always read back values it writes to tdata registers, unless it already knows what is supported. This fix correctly ensures that the WARL behaviour of tdata CSRs. Fixes: a42bd001 ("target/riscv: debug: Determine the trigger type from tdata1.type") Signed-off-by: Abhigyan Kumar <[email protected]> --- target/riscv/tcg/debug.c | 3 ++- 1 file changed, 2 insertions(+), 1 deletion(-) diff --git a/target/riscv/tcg/debug.c b/target/riscv/tcg/debug.c index 3c0fe7010..ae493235d 100644 --- a/target/riscv/tcg/debug.c +++ b/target/riscv/tcg/debug.c @@ -913,7 +913,8 @@ void tdata_csr_write(CPURISCVState *env, int tdata_index, target_ulong val) trigger_type); break; default: - g_assert_not_reached(); + qemu_log_mask(LOG_GUEST_ERROR, "trigger type: %d is unassigned\n", + trigger_type); } }
